Madinah vs Byrd Climate & Distance Between

Antarctica flag
  • The distance between Madinah, Saudi Arabia and Byrd, Antarctica is approximately 13,769 km or 8,556 mi.
  • To reach Madinah in this distance one would set out from Byrd bearing 157.2° or SSE and follow the great circles arc to approach Madinah bearing 4.2° or N .
  • Madinah has a subtropical hot desert climate (BWh) whereas Byrd has a ice cap climate (EF).
  • The average temperature is 56 °C (100.8°F) warmer.
  • Average monthly temperatures vary by 4.4 °C (7.9°F) less in Madinah. The continentality subtype is semicontinental as opposed to subcontinental.
  • Total annual precipitation averages 19.1 mm (0.8 in) more which is equivalent to 19.1 l/m² (0.47 US gal/ft²) or 191,000 l/ha (20,419 US gal/ac) more. About 1 2/3 as much.
  • The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 56° higher in Madinah than in Byrd.
